What are IoT Development Platforms for AWS IoT Device Defender?

IoT development platforms are suites of tools that provide the software, hardware and services needed to develop and manage applications for connected devices. These platforms allow developers to access remote collection points, such as sensors or other networks, to control the devices and interact with them in real time. They also provide multiple development environments, allowing developers to develop applications with an array of languages, frameworks and protocols. IoT development platforms offer secure data storage and communication capabilities to ensure the security of data collected from connected devices.     AWS Greengrass
    AWS IoT Greengrass seamlessly extends AWS to edge devices so they can act locally on the data they generate, while still using the cloud for management, analytics, and durable storage. With AWS IoT Greengrass, connected devices can run AWS Lambda functions, Docker containers, or both, execute predictions based on machine learning models, keep device data in sync, and communicate with other devices securely – even when not connected to the Internet. With AWS IoT Greengrass, you can use familiar languages and programming models to create and test your device software in the cloud, and then deploy it to your devices. AWS IoT Greengrass can be programmed to filter device data, manage the life cyle of that data on the device, and only transmit necessary information back to AWS. You can also connect to third-party applications, on-premises software, and AWS services out-of-the-box with AWS IoT Greengrass Connectors.
